The future is Windsgar
To be honest, at first I was totally hesitant to listen to a ttrpg on a podcast after having watched them on twitch and YouTube for a few years (hence why I’m joining this campaign three years after it’s inception) but my love for essentially everything Gina does prevailed and I couldn’t be happier with my choice.
Trevor is a great and inventive DM with amazing voices. Gina has me laughing and smiling every time Windsgar speaks or does something. Elly provides the darker side of humor that I love entirely. Alyssa, though at this point the more quieter of the crew, provides her own little interesting story in Anise. Joey gives different dimensions to a bird fighter who thinks he’s pretty darn tough. And Paul provides some tunes that are catchy and plays a classic bard character to the letter. Everyone’s comedic and dramatic timing is A+ and I’ll honestly be binging this podcast for a long while just so I can unravel what sort of backstories might lie beneath the surface of this strange crew of characters as well as the promise of new characters I know will appear along the way
